Mushroom and Chicken Risotto
By avpeters
1. In a large pot, heat the butter over moderate heat
- If you're using canned chicken broth to make risotto, be sure it's low-sodium. The broth reduces at the same time that it's cooking into the rice, and regular canned broth would become much too salty.
- INGREDIENTS
- • 2 tablespoons butter
- • 1/2 pound mushrooms, cut into thin slices
- • 2/3 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 2), cut into 1/2-inch pieces
- • 1 teaspoon salt
- • 1/4 teaspoon fresh-ground black pepper
- • 5 1/2 cups canned low-sodium chicken broth or homemade stock, more if needed
- • 1 tablespoon cooking oil
- • 1/2 cup chopped onion
- • 1 1/2 cups arborio rice
- • 1/2 cup dry white wine
- •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ese, plus more for serving
- •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
